Vamba Sherif's The Emperor's Son is a gripping tale of Zaiwulo, a young prodigy dispatched to the ancient city of Musadu to train under the tutelage of Talata, a renowned sage of the legendary Haidarah family. In his new surroundings, the young Zaiwulo finds himself entangled in a web of intrigue surrounding Emperor Samori, the formidable leader whom the French have dubbed " the Black Napoleon."As Zaiwulo matures into a formidable soldier, fighting alongside the Emperor, his quest for truth intensifies, leading him on a daring adventure that ultimately brings him face-to-face with his own origins. Set against the backdrop of political upheaval and historical tumult, The Emperor's Son is a riveting historical saga of loyalty, the pursuit of identity, the complexities of leadership, and the enduring quest for truth in a world that is constantly evolving.

The proud Republic of Liberia was founded in the 19th century with the triumphant return of the freed slaves from America to Africa.The proud Republic of Liberia was founded in the 19th century with the triumphant return of the freed slaves from America to Africa. Once back 'home', however, these Americo-Liberians had to integrate with the resident tribes - who did not want or welcome them. Against a background of French and British colonialists busily carving up Mother Africa, while local tribes were still unashamedly trading in slaves . . . the vulnerable newcomers felt trapped and out of place. Where men should have stood shoulder to shoulder, they turned on each other instead.Land of My Fathers plunges us into this world. But in the midst of turmoil, there is friendship. Edward Richard, a man born into slavery and a preacher by profession, is convinced that the future of Liberia lies in bringing peace amongst the tribes. His mission takes him to the far north, where he meets an extraordinary man, Halay. Edward's new and dearest friend is ready to sacrifice his own life to protect his country; for the Liberians believe that with Halay's death, no war will ever threaten their land. A century later, this belief is crushed when war engulfs the land, bearing away with it the descendants of both Edward and Halay. The story of Halay is the untold story of Liberia. What he did would come to stand as symbol of man's ability to defy the odds, to face the inevitable head on.

Es herrscht sengende Hitze, als William Mawolo aus dem Bus steigt. Er ist fremd in Wologizi und er kommt mit einem geheimen Auftrag. Der Kommandant der kleinen Grenzstadt ist mitsamt seiner Truppe spurlos verschwunden. William soll die Sache aufklären. Unauffällig versucht er Erkundigungen einzuziehen. Doch in kürzester Zeit weiß die ganze Stadt, was der Fremde wirklich will und William stößt entweder auf eine Mauer des Schweigens oder auf die widersprüchlichsten Behauptungen. Nach und nach aber entsteht ein Bild vom verschwundenen Kommandanten Tetese. Einst ein Versager, der von der Hand in den Mund lebte, stieg er zum gefürchteten Befehlshaber auf wie konnte das geschehen? Und wie war es dem hässlichen Tetese gelungen, die begehrteste Frau der Stadt zu verführen und mit ihr eine Tochter von rätselhafter Schönheit zu zeugen? Gründe, Tetese zu hassen, hatten viele in Wologizi. William sieht sich von Geheimnissen umgeben und dass er sich in die schöne Tochter Teteses verliebt, macht seinen Verstand nicht eben klarer. Als schließlich auch noch ein jahrhundertealter Zauber seine unheimliche Kraft entfaltet, droht William seine mühsam gewahrte Fassung endgültig zu verlieren. - Vamba Sherif wurde 1973 in Liberia geboren. Seine Jugend verbrachte er zum größten Teil in Kuwait, wo er sich mit arabischer, europäischer und afrikanischer Literatur beschäftigte. Die irakische Invasion zwang ihn 1993 zur Flucht in die Niederlande. Hier nahm er ein Jurastudium auf und begann getrieben durch die Erfahrung des Exils zu schreiben. 1999 veröffentlichte Vamba Sherif im Alter von 26 Jahren seinen ersten Roman "Het land van de vaders".
